Runbook: bulk edits in the Cobblewise admin table are applied in batches of 200 rows. Plugin authors must declare a pre-commit hook if they mutate row state, or edits will silently skip their validation. Timeouts over 5s abort the whole batch, not just the row. Test against the sandbox tenant first. Reference the sandbox build marker printed below.

pipeline stamp: htk9_ce63042d9

## Resharding the Profile Store

When splitting the Lumenpath user-profile store, always run the shard-map diff before cutover and verify that encryption keys are re-scoped per shard, not copied wholesale. Each migration batch must be signed by the Keyline service, and audit events should land in the tamper-evident log within five minutes. Rollback requires the frozen shard map from the prior epoch. The full key-handling checklist, including reviewer sign-off steps, lives on our internal wiki page.

runbook for hawif-tajeg: https://grafana.plorvasoft.example/dash

Step 4: Migrating the Alertmere fan-out. Before switching the weather-alert distributor to the new queue topology, drain the legacy topic completely and confirm zero in-flight storm notices. Subscribers in the Bramhollow region must be re-registered first, since their routing keys changed shape. Once the drain check passes, restart the fan-out worker with the configuration values listed directly below.

service settings:
[casax]
port = 6379
team = rusir
host = casax.zemvarhq.corp
region = outer-4
access_code = ac_9808ce
timeout_ms = 1500

Minutes — Management Meeting, Branch Managers' Session. Attendees reviewed the joint venture proposal from Halloway & Brint covering regional distribution. Terms discussed: 60/40 equity split, shared warehousing at Netherfold, three-year initial term. Legal review is underway; no commitments made. Branch impacts to be assessed next month. Supporting detail appears below.

confidential, yahip-hagug: Gorixax Logistics plans to lower the Ulaael list price by 26.6 percent in October. The pricing group signed off on a budget of $199.9 million for Project Holix. The renewal with Kasdorox Systems closes at $137.5 million a year, 8.2 percent above the last contract. Project Lamion slips by a full year because of the audit delay.